    Updated Review: Major Headaches, Partial Redemption — Be Cautious With American Standard and Team Air

    I previously warned about my frustrating experience with American Standard and Team Air, and I want to update the review to reflect the full picture now that the situation is (finally) resolved.

    The Problem
    In 2022, I purchased an American Standard HVAC system through Smith’s Quality Heating & Cooling. Within 24 months, the unit suffered:

    Two failed compressors

    A frozen heat pump due to a leaking coil

    Four warranty claims

    Persistent performance problems

    The most recent compressor replacement (installed June 3, 2025) failed within 5 days. Clearly, I was sold a defective unit—but instead of owning the issue, American Standard hid behind their warranty, providing no real accountability or urgency.

    Who Did What
    Smith’s Quality Heating & Cooling was not the problem. They're a small company that genuinely tried to help:

    They absorbed the labor and refrigerant costs each time repairs were needed.

    They performed the warranty repairs even though the repeated failures were out of their control.

    They were ultimately left in the lurch by Team Air, the distributor responsible for regional warranty support.

    Team Air, on the other hand, shifted blame instead of taking ownership. When the second replacement compressor failed, they claimed an electrical inspection was needed (despite no evidence of such a problem). I provided that inspection, proving there was no issue—and still, I was met with stonewalling.

    Resolution — Thanks to Trevor
    What finally turned things around was Trevor from Team Air. He stepped in when no one else would:

    He worked directly with American Standard.

    He was responsive, professional, and took ownership where others didn’t.

    He helped coordinate the new equipment so a new HVAC professional could properly install it.

    Thanks to Trevor's efforts and the new installer, I now have a functioning, system.
